Lypsa Gems & Jewellery Limited (LYPSAGEMS) has a Net Asset Quality Index of 25.7% as of September 2025. This metric measures the proportion of total assets financed by shareholders' equity — total assets of Rs647.43 Million minus total liabilities of Rs481.31 Million yields net assets of Rs166.13 Million.
